Six desecrating Turkish flag detained in Jarabulus
Six people, who tried to desecrate a Turkish flag during demonstrations against Türkiye in the northern Syrian province of Jarabulus, have been detained, İhlas News Agency has reported.
According to the report, "provocateurs" caused an uprising in the city on Aug. 11 and tried to take a Turkish flag down, following statements by Türkiye's top diplomat Mevlüt Çavuşoğlu.

Astana partners express concerns over rising terror attacks in northern Syria
The Astana Group, comprised of Turkey, Russia and Iran, has expressed concerns over the rising terror attacks against the civilians in northern Syria, while drawing attention to separatist agendas that threaten the security of Syria and neighboring countries.
Turkey, Russia to review ties in key areas
Turkey and Russia will carry out a comprehensive review of their bilateral relationship and regional cooperation in the Syrian, Libyan and Nagorno-Karabakh theaters and will plan 2021-2022 diplomatic consultations, including the next Turkish-Russian high-level cooperation council at the presidential level.

AKP delivers charter draft to MHP
Turkey's ruling Justice and Development Party (AKP) officially delivered its draft for a new constitution to the Nationalist Movement Party (MHP) on Nov. 15, days after the leaders of both parties agreed on the principles of changes that will pave the way for the adoption of a presidential system.
